Background

FMF is a non-profit and non-governmental organization aiming to provide health, nutrition, food security and protection services as a humanitarian response to the escalating socio-economic situation in Yemen since 2012.

Duties and Responsibilities: - 

  • Assist the project officer to coordinate the implementation of food security project as well as assist the team to plan, prepare and conducting distributions of food and cash.
  • Ensure that project activities and outputs are implemented in a timely manner. 
  • To technically mentor and supervise Assistant food Security Officers working under his supervision as well as carry out Staff performance Ensure high quality reports are submitted in a timely manner and work closely with the project officer to ensure reports meet donor requirements.
  • Break down the annual operational plans into weekly, monthly and quarterly implementation plans.
  • Develop and maintain contacts with all relevant stakeholders including government, security forces, partner organizations.
  • Cooperate with government institutions, non-government organizations, and the local community.
  • Regularly attend cluster coordination and other relevant meetings;
  • • Represent the project/program in front of relevant stakeholders.
  • Regularly share information on lessons learnt in the field. 
  • conduct project team coordination meeting on weekly and monthly basis and prepare weekly, monthly and quarterly reports to the project management.
  • Work with affected communities and establish close relationships with them;
  • Supervise enumerators during distributions and in the process of data collection.
  • Report security incidences in the field in a timely manner to the Security officer.
  • Report any incidences related to protection of IDPs and host-communities to the management.
  • Any other task assigned by the line manager.
